Interest in dreams is as old as humankind. Interest in dream telepathy -- the idea that we can influence others' dreams and communicate through them -- has been around almost as long. Dream Telepathy is Montague Ullman and Stanley Krippner's 1973 report on their ten years of research and experimentation with the human power to communicate across the barriers of time, space, and sleep. Ullman, a psychoanalyst, and Krippner, a psychologist, were the heads of the dream-research team at Maimonides Medical Center's Dream Laboratory in New York throughout the 1960s and early 1970s. Using graduate student researchers and volunteer subjects from the community, Ullman and Krippner engineered experiments wherein the researchers focused on a selection of art prints while, in another room, the subjects slept and dreamt. Meeting with varying degrees of success depending upon the research pair, subjects reported astonishing things, often dreaming their own uncannily accurate interpretation of the artistic scene the researchers were attempting to project to them. Dream Telepathy proposes the invaluable theoretical implications of such experimentation, and presupposes the use of dream telepathy in all areas of paranormal studies.

This book is the first to scientifically explore the phenomenon of telepathic dreaming in depth. It recounts how psychiatrist Montague Ullman and psychologist Stanley Krippner conducted experiments to determine whether persons acting as senders can transfer their thoughts to the minds of sleeping receivers, thereby altering their dreams. Their results were astonishing: the researchers were able to verify several instances of telepathic communication between participants. Participants often gave uncannily accurate descriptions of images that the senders attempted to project to them - apparently confirming the reality of extrasensory perception during the dream state. In fascinating detail, the authors explain the intriguing process and results of their 10-year study, researching and experimenting with the human ability to communicate across the barriers of time, space, and sleep. They also review the history of previous research in this area, describe their own controlled experimental procedures, document their subjects' reactions, provide transcripts of several dream sessions, and critically engage with scientific reviewers. All this is done in straightforward language, making the book accessible to both general readers and serious scholars. Rarely has a scientific work been so readable, engaging, and entertaining. This new 50th Anniversary Edition features a never-before-published article by Montague Ullman on interpreting dreams in light of theoretical physicist David Bohm's concept of an implicate order; and a new afterword by Stanley Krippner, highlighting recent developments in dream telepathy research.

When published in 1973, this was the first book to present and analyze the results of scientifically controlled experiments in extrasensory perception during the dream state. This updated, revised and expanded edition now represents the most current and authoritative source of information available.The main body presents experiments by the authors over a ten year period to determine if persons acting as "agents" could transfer their thoughts to the minds of sleeping "subjects" and influence their dreams. Subjects' reactions, transcripts of recollected dreams and their associations with "targets," accounts of particularly unusual telepathic communication between participants, descriptions of the experimental procedures, and a summary of statistical results are recorded. Their findings, written in straightforward language, will interest the general reader and serious scholar alike.

Dream telepathy was demonstrated in the laboratory in the early 1970s. Is it real? Can ordinary people do it? Does it occur spontaneously in natural settings? Randall explored what factors in group dynamics brought people together with unusual harmony. At a conference on Shamanism at the Atlantic University, he noticed the role that dreams played in the community's cohesion. He explored what happens when people share their dreams. On one particularly interesting evening, the group conducted an experiment based upon Henry Reed's Dream Helper ceremony, and Robert Van De Castle's dream telepathy research. The group endeavored to reach one member's psyche and achieve group dreaming. Hence this became a field study under natural conditions of dream telepathy. Did it work? What actually happened? What did the group think happened? Is it really Dream Telepathy? Dream Healing? Shared mind or shared metaphor?
